description S4. Palaeogeographic sketch for Early Campanian. Distribution of the foraminifera and radiolaria in the EEP and in the Crimea–Caucasus area. White colour—land, area of denudation or erosian; blue colour—marine sediments. 1— Oxytoma teniucostata (Roemer), boreal bivalve migrant from Western Siberia; 2— Marsupites testudinarius Schlotheim, crinoids from Tethys area. Calcareous benthic foraminifera of the Pseudogavelinella clementiana Zone: 3— P. clementiana (d'Orbigny); 4— Bolivinoides decoratus Jones. Planktonic foraminifera of Globotruncana arca beds on Mangyshlak MTS: 5— Globotruncana arca (Cushman); planktonic foraminifera of Globotruncanita elevata Zone in Crimea–Caucasus area: 6— Globotruncanita elevata (Brotzen). Radiolaria: 7—boreal radiolaria Prunobrachidae .
